Obituary For Alice Dean

It is with heavy hearts that we announce the peaceful passing of Alice Loraine Dean on Sunday, August 7, 2016, at Points West Hospice in Grande Prairie, AB at the age of 64 years.

Alice was born in Toronto, ON on June 1, 1952. She was a daughter of the late Loraine Neil and Andrew “Roy” Neil, now of St. John, NB.

Mourning their deep loss are her three children: sons Lloyd (Pilar) of Port Moody, BC, Jeffory (Kayla and her son Tristan) of La Glace, AB; and daughter Tammy (Alphonse “Fonz”) of Aspen Grove, AB. She will be truly missed by her sister Josie (Randy Pike) of Westfield, NB, special nephew Jonathan Pike (Priscilla and their son Caél) of Fort McMurray, AB, as well as several nieces, nephews and in-laws in Newfoundland.

The bright lights in her life were her four 'Sugar Bears'....her grandchildren: Kody and Kayden Short, Jack Dean, and Gage Dean. She liked nothing better than to spend time with her boys. Each boy had his own door frame where his growth was recorded annually. Her cupboards always hid a few treats that they might not have been allowed at home. Sleepovers at Grandma's were the best.

Besides her husband and her mother, Alice was also predeceased by her parents in-law, Ethel and Willam Dean.

Following her marriage to William Dean she moved to Newfoundland, where together they raised their three children of whom they were very proud. After Will's death in 2003, Alice moved to Alberta to be nearer those children.

At the time of her death, Alice was employed with Wapiti Gravel, a job she thoroughly enjoyed. She was a scrap booker extraordinaire, ardent reader (belonging to a local book club in Aspen Grove) and shopper. In her later years, Alice did some travelling and was always ready for an adventure. She was an excellent cook and her family started anticipating her Christmas packages in November, which arrived in the mail filled with her delicious cakes, cookies, and squares. They were always received with great delight. Alice loved having her family around her table whenever their work schedules allowed for a meal.

Sheldon Jones, her best friend, will miss her smile, their chats and the hi-jinks they would occasionally get up to. Thank you, Sheldon, for being there for our Mom at the drop of a hat. We will never forget your kindness.

Alice also leaves behind her canine companion, Callie. Callie showed up on her doorstep a few years ago and, being the kind hearted person she was, Alice invited the scrawny dark furred dog in. It wasn't until after a bath that she discovered Callie's fur is white. During her illness Callie never left Alice's side.
